Transaction d177a6f6616b49f317b1b43afd025b11d89c6831bd804858c5a95224e037cd27
1 Input
1 Output
-
d177a6f6616b49f317b1b43afd025b11d89c6831bd804858c5a95224e037cd27:0
- value
- 149998719
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4406781896b420e1ee257d96a151b5c30cbd27b8 OP_EQUAL
- address
- 37thd54q9Y2iftnzp8NvpqKHFa84NXQdEs